Multi-Pitch Skill Development
The climbing in Eldo lends itself to any number of skill development opportunities. There is amazing toproping in Eldo, but the best aspects of the venue are the endless supply of multi-pitch climbs. Many routes have short pitches with comfortable belays making a great classroom for impromptu rope management or anchoring lessons. We often combine time in Eldo with more committing alpine trips as it is an excellent venue to gain the technical skills needed for many routes in Rocky Mountain National Park.

Rock climbing in Eldorado Canyon is life. So much of our connection to the world and the places we love is drawn from our experiences. The West Buttress of the Bastille is a great place to get “in touch” with Eldo!
By a good margin the most popular route on the Bastille is “The Bastille Crack” at a moderate grade of 5.7+. The West Buttress is host to a number of amazing climbs such as The West Arete, The West Buttress proper, and Blind Faith.
Redgarden Wall
Many of the most signifant climbs in the canyon are located on the Redgarden Wall. From Moderate classics such as Yellow Spur to the ultra-classic Naked Edge.
